If you get room 101, run. Otherwise you’ll have to swim with the first rain. We got this room despite booking and paying for one of a higher category. It was the beginning of one of the worst accommodation experiences we’ve had as frequent travellers.
In a nutshell: We had to approach the staff multiple times before they agreed to move us to the room we booked. We still had to stay the first night in the room that should have been cheaper. It had a non-functioning fan and a mosquito net full of holes. No offer of any compensation was made. On the morning of the second day, it rained and the entire room got flooded in minutes. I had my suitcase open on one of the beds, and it rained into it. All my clothes, money, and electronics got soaked. I can’t imagine what it would have been like if somebody slept on that bed. This was the moment when I requested a refund for the first night. This was completely ignored by the staff. There was no apology, no compensation offered, not even a little “have a drink on us” gesture. From this moment on, the staff started avoiding us. We wanted to keep fighting, but then we read that other people had similar experiences and the management got borderline aggressive. In the end we didn’t feel safe pursuing the topic with them.
Other reasons never to come to Kusini: Very frequent power outages. Even for Zanzibar. Expect to be without electricity multiple times per hour. Long waiting times for everything. Again, even for Zanzibar. Christmas dinner took almost 3 hours to be served. Breakfast usually 1 hour for a fruit platter. Mosquito nets full of holes in two out of two rooms we slept in. Not so great if malaria is on your list of diseases you want to avoid.
All in all, this overpriced and undermaintained accommodation with management that treats you like a cash cow that will never come back anyway made for an unforgettable experience, no matter how much we’re trying to forget.
